Bourgonje wins Canada’s first Paralympic medal

Canadian Colette Bourgonje won the silver medal in today's women's sitting 10km cross country ski race, the first medal for Canada at the Vancouver 2010 Paralympic Games, in a time of 31 minutes, 49.8 seconds.
